5.
Specify slots to be used by Data Protector.
Click Next.
6.
Select the media type used in the library.
Click Next.
7.
Click Finish and then click Yes to configure drives in the library.
8.
Type a name for the drive. Optionally, describe the drive.
In Client, select the NDMP client that will control the library through the NDMP
Server.
In NDMP Server, select the NDMP Server system with the library robotics
connected to it.
In Data Format, select the NAS device used.
Click Next.
9.
Specify the drive's NDMP SCSI address. For information, see
configuration" on page 176 and
Do not change the drive index number.
Click Next.
10.
Specify the media pool.
To specify advanced device options, click Advanced. For information on
supported block sizes, see
NOTE:
Multiplexing data streams is not supported by NDMP Server, limiting device
concurrency to 1.
